From Hardship to Hip-Hop: The Inspiring Journey of Swayzo

When Jordan Simmons, better known by his stage name Swayzo, speaks about his life, it’s clear that music isn’t just a passion – it’s a calling. A way to make sense of the hardships he’s faced and to honor the memory of his father. Growing up in Dayton, Ohio, Swayzo was surrounded by the rhythms of hip-hop from a young age. His dad was a rapper with albums out and a clothing brand called U-BAUL, an acronym for “You Believe to Achieve Unlimited Levels.” But despite the musical influence at home, Swayzo’s path to pursuing his own rap career was far from straightforward.

Swayzo’s early adult years were marked by time in and out of jail, a cycle that made it difficult for him to find a productive outlet for his creativity and energy. But everything changed when his father tragically died in a car accident. The loss was devastating, but it also sparked a newfound determination in Swayzo. He realized that he couldn’t waste any more time – he had to chase his dreams, just as his dad had always encouraged him to do.

Since his release from federal prison, Swayzo has been focused on his music, pouring his experiences and emotions into his lyrics. He believes that his authenticity is what sets him apart. “I really lived the life of taking penitentiary chances to pay the bills and took sacrifices through a lot to get the job done,” he explains. “I felt the best way to express what I’ve been through was music.”

Swayzo’s music is raw and honest, with lyrics that paint vivid pictures of his past struggles and his current mindset. As Swayzo prepares to release his upcoming EP “Different Breed,” he’s fueled by a desire to inspire others. He hopes his story and his music will motivate people to chase their dreams, no matter how impossible they may seem. “I want to set the tone for the ones who don’t have a dream and even for the ones who do but tend to doubt themselves,” he says. “I want to be a good example for our generations coming up and of course, to get mama out that apartment.”

With his talent, passion, and unwavering determination, Swayzo is on a mission to make a name for himself in the hip-hop world. His journey hasn’t been easy, but through his music, he’s transforming his hardships into a source of strength and inspiration. As he continues to rise, Swayzo is proof that with belief in oneself and an unstoppable work ethic, anything is possible.
